Enhancing AI Interactions with Advanced Prompting Techniques
As artificial intelligence becomes increasingly integral across various sectors, mastering the art of prompt engineering is crucial for anyone looking to leverage AI effectively. Prompt engineering involves crafting specific queries or inputs that guide AI models to produce desired outcomes, whether generating text, coding, creating art, or solving complex problems. The phrasing of prompts significantly impacts the AI's performance. Here, we refine techniques to elevate your AI interactions, including role-based prompting and utilizing AI chat tools for effective prompts.
Understand the AI Model’s Capabilities and Limitations
Example: Before prompting an AI to translate text, understand that a model trained on scientific literature may not perform well with colloquial language.
Be Specific and Concise
AI operates optimally with clear instructions. Keeping prompts straightforward yet detailed helps guide the AI without ambiguity.
Example:
- Less Effective: "Tell me about technology advancements."
- More Effective: "Provide an overview of the top three advancements in blockchain technology in the past year."
Use Clear and Direct Language
Complex or ambiguous language can mislead the model, so clarity in language choice is crucial.
Example:
- Ambiguous: "Can you talk about the weather?"
- Clear: "What is the current weather in Paris?"
Incorporate Examples
Providing examples within your prompt can serve as a blueprint for the AI, showing precisely what you’re looking for in terms of tone, structure, and content.
Example:
- Prompt: "Generate a product description similar to the following example: 'Explore new horizons with our state-of-the-art GPS technology, designed for both the avid adventurer and the casual traveler.'"
Role-Based Prompting
Assign roles or personas to the AI to tailor its responses according to desired expertise.
Example:
- Without Role: "Write a paragraph about maintaining client relationships."
- With Role: "As a seasoned customer service manager, write a detailed guide on maintaining excellent client relationships."
Iterate and Refine
Prompting is often iterative; refine your prompts based on AI responses to enhance clarity and relevance.
Example:
- Initial Prompt: "Email about project progress."
- Refined Prompt: "Compose a detailed email updating the client on the project's progress, emphasizing milestones achieved and next steps."
Evaluate Outcomes Critically
Assess AI output to ensure alignment with queries and objectives. This critical evaluation helps fine-tune future prompts.
Example:
- Initial Output: "Project is ongoing."
- Evaluation: "Add specific details about project phases completed and expected completion dates."
Contextual Adaptation
Adapt prompts to fit the task's specific context, varying levels of creativity, or analytical depth as needed.
Example:
- Creative Task: "Write a poem about the tranquility of forests in autumn."
- Analytical Task: "Analyze the trend in deforestation rates in South America from 2000 to 2020."
Conclusion
Effective prompt engineering ensures more accurate and relevant AI outputs. By employing advanced techniques such as role-based prompting and leveraging AI chat tools, you can enhance the quality of AI interactions. These strategies help engage AI technologies more effectively across creative, technical, and analytical tasks.
Stay tuned for more insights and practical tips at Aman Bhandal's blog.
Comments ()